Hey, I plan on applying in July as well. Can you tell me what you studied for the hesi?

They change the HESI every time and from what I heard, they have a couple hundred questions and it's all randomized. The anatomy section was only 30 ?s but that is kind of hard to study for since its such a broad subject and since there are only 30 questions it doesn't give you any room to miss one. I used the HESI A2 study guide by Trivium Test Prep. I liked it because it summarized each subject of a&p with the essential info, so I just pretty much read everything. Vocab was mostly health-related words like adhere, supplement etc. Grammar was easy for me but my friend failed that section so I don't know...I would say just study affect/effect and remember neither goes with nor and either goes with or in a sentence. Reading is super easy don't even sweat it! Math is all fractions and proportions with a couple unit conversions thrown in. Just know meters to kilometers and pints to cups.
